Montblanc Marlene Dietrich 1901 Silver and Diamonds Limited Edition Fountain Pen 101402, 2007

The Montblanc Marlene Dietrich Commemoration Edition reflects the charisma of a woman who, beyond her achievement as an actress, has left a legacy which is both timeless and enduring. The Edition is dedicated to today's generation of women who, like Marlene Dietrich, believe in the power of their dreams and have the conviction to fulfil their visions.

Marlene Dietrich is a timeless phenomenon. Her unparalleled career in the history of motion pictures made her a living legend. Famous film directors engaged her for their movies and made her immortal on celluloid. Marlene received highest accolades but always remained loyal to her ideals. In later years she concentrated on her 'second career' as a singer and entertainer. At an age, most stars would have been happy to slip into semi-retirement, she still filled up theatres.

Launch: August 2007
Limitation: 1,901 Fountain Pens
101402

• Body and cap are oval at the end, rounded in the middle and conversely twisted to simulate a feminine silhouette
• Cap and barrel made of 925 Sterling Silver, embellished with a fine barley guilloche and mother-of-pearl inlays at the top and bottom
• Clip crafted like a tie, set with a dark blue sapphire and 6 brilliant-cut diamonds
• Cap ring studded with 16 brilliant-cut diamonds
• Signature of Marlene Dietrich engraved on the barrel
• Hand-crafted platinum-plated 18 K gold nib with heart shaped hole
